Python是一種強大的編程語言,其中一個常見的操作就是將字符變為大寫。通過使用Python內置的upper()函數,我們可以輕松地將字符串中的所有字符轉換為大寫形式。這種操作在數據處理、文本處理和字符串匹配等方面非常有用。Python的upper()函數可以幫助我們快速實現這一功能,提高編程效率。
**為什么要將字符轉換為大寫?**
_x000D_將字符轉換為大寫形式可以統一數據格式,避免大小寫帶來的匹配錯誤。在比較字符串時,忽略大小寫可以簡化邏輯判斷,提高程序的可讀性和準確性。大寫字符在輸出時通常更易讀,符合一般的文本習慣。
_x000D_**如何在Python中將字符轉換為大寫?**
_x000D_在Python中,可以使用字符串對象的upper()方法來將字符轉換為大寫形式。例如,對于字符串"hello",可以通過調用"hello".upper()來得到大寫形式的字符串"HELLO"。這是一種簡單而高效的方法,適用于各種場景下的字符處理需求。
_x000D_**有沒有其他方法可以實現字符轉換為大寫?**
_x000D_除了upper()方法外,還可以使用Python內置的str.upper()函數來實現字符轉換為大寫。還可以通過ASCII碼進行轉換,將小寫字母的ASCII碼減去32即可得到對應的大寫字母的ASCII碼。這種方法更加底層,適合對字符編碼有一定了解的開發者使用。
_x000D_